Starship Prompt

Fast, minimal, infinitely customizable

Starship is a cross-shell prompt written in Rust. It's fast (typically <10ms), configurable, and works in any shell. The dotfiles include a custom SilkCircuit theme with a beautiful gradient design.

Configuration

Located at /Users/bliss/dev/dotfiles/starship/starship.toml

Common Customizations

Enable time display:

toml
[time]
disabled = false
format = '󱑍 [$time]($style) '
time_format = "%H:%M"
style = "bold fg:#FF6666"

Show more directory segments:

toml
[directory]
truncation_length = 5  # Show 5 levels instead of 3
truncation_symbol = "…/"
truncate_to_repo = false  # Don't truncate at git root

Custom git symbols:

toml
[git_branch]
symbol = "🌿 "  # Emoji
# or
symbol = " "  # Nerd Font icon

Change colors:

toml
[directory]
style = "bold fg:#00ffff"  # Cyan directories

[git_branch]
style = "bold fg:#ff1493"  # Deep pink branches

[nodejs]
style = "bold fg:#68a063"  # Green Node version

Add hostname (for SSH):

toml
[hostname]
ssh_only = true  # Only show when SSH'd
format = "[@$hostname]($style) "
style = "bold fg:#FF66FF"
disabled = false

Disable modules:

toml
[docker_context]
disabled = true  # Hide Docker context

[kubernetes]
disabled = true  # Hide K8s context

[battery]
disabled = true  # Hide battery

Performance

Starship is extremely fast thanks to being written in Rust:

bash
# Benchmark your prompt
time starship prompt
# Typically: 5-15ms

# Profile slow modules
starship timings

Optimization Tips

If your prompt feels slow:

  1. Disable unused modules:
toml
[python]
disabled = true
  1. Reduce directory depth:
toml
[directory]
truncation_length = 1
  1. Disable command duration:
toml
[cmd_duration]
disabled = true
  1. Use scan_timeout for slow detections:
toml
[nodejs]
detect_files = ["package.json"]
scan_timeout = 10  # milliseconds

Shell Integration

Starship is automatically initialized in zsh/zshrc via Zinit:

bash
# Zinit loads and initializes Starship
zinit ice atload"eval \"\$(starship init zsh)\""
zinit light starship/starship

This lazy-loads Starship for fast shell startup.

Manual Initialization (If Needed)

bash
# Zsh
eval "$(starship init zsh)"

# Bash
eval "$(starship init bash)"

# Fish
starship init fish | source

Troubleshooting

Prompt Not Showing

Issue: Plain prompt, no Starship theme

Solution:

bash
# Check if Starship is installed
which starship

# Verify config exists
ls -la ~/.config/starship.toml

# Check for errors
starship explain

# Manually initialize
eval "$(starship init zsh)"
source ~/.zshrc

Icons Not Rendering

Issue: Boxes or weird characters instead of icons

Solution:

Install a Nerd Font (see Installation Guide):

bash
# macOS
brew install --cask font-jetbrains-mono-nerd-font

# Configure your terminal to use the Nerd Font

Colors Look Wrong

Issue: Colors are off or not matching the theme

Solution:

bash
# Check terminal color support
echo $TERM
# Should output: xterm-256color or screen-256color

# Force 256 colors if needed
export TERM=xterm-256color

Configuration Examples

Minimal Prompt

toml
format = """
$directory\
$git_branch\
$character
"""

[directory]
truncation_length = 2

Two-Line Prompt

toml
format = """
$username\
$hostname\
$directory\
$git_branch\
$git_status
$character """

[character]
success_symbol = "[❯](bold green)"
error_symbol = "[❯](bold red)"

Time + Duration Focus

toml
format = """
$time\
$directory\
$git_branch\
$cmd_duration
$character """

[time]
disabled = false
format = "[$time]($style) "

[cmd_duration]
min_time = 100  # Show all commands > 100ms
